American sinologist Stephen Owen is an expert specializing in classical poetry and Chinese literature. In his works"Remembrance", a book with academic speculation and literal interest, Owen mentioned synecdoche in Chinese literature. Synecdoche is a process in which the author bridge human and nature by using his/her imagination, or by means of figure of speech by which a part is put for the whole; and the readers comprehend the author's limited and uncompleted expression. Synecdoche is a description of Chinese traditional literature language and poetry reading habit, which generalizes how literature forerunners create poetry and how they interpret poetry. This dissertation tries to discuss the phenomenon of synecdoche and Stephen Owen's unique research methods by studying some of his works, implores the synecdoche in classical literary works and literary theory and discovers the significance of Stephen Owen's critical practice and global academic background.In addition to the introduction and the conclusion, this dissertation is divided into five parts. The introduction gives a brief introduction to Stephen Owen's academic career, his philosophy of Chinese literature and a brief presentation of the theme of the whole dissertation.Chapter one provides Stephen Owen's idea: synecdoche in classical Chinese literature which generalizes how literature forerunners create poetry and how they interpret poetry.Chapter two takes mist and remembrance as examples and discusses synecdoche in classical literary work from the perspective of Owen's unique interpretation style. Chapter three implores synecdoche in Chinese literary theory from the perspective of Owen's interpretation on Chinese literary terms and Ouyangxiu's"Liuyi Shihua".The conclusion gives the summary of the whole dissertation and assesses the value and influence of Owen's Chinese literature study.
